Reporting to the Food & Beverage Assistant Managers, you'll be based at Calke Abbey (Derby, DE73 7JF), one of the East Midlands’ top 10 visitor attractions. The newly refurbished restaurant serves local and seasonal produce, including organically reared meat from the estate. As well as the house, Calke is popular with visitors looking to explore the gardens, pleasure grounds, stable yards, and the 600+ acre estate including an ancient deer park, wetland and nature reserve. Our popular commercial spaces such as the restaurant, café, pop-up refreshments and shop help to make much of Calke’s extensive conservation work possible.
